How do I choose the right size wakeboarding equipment bag for my gear?

Choosing the right size wakeboarding equipment bag for your gear can seem like a daunting task, but it’s actually quite straightforward. Start by making a list of all the gear you need to carry with you, including your wakeboard, bindings, rope, and any other essentials. Then, measure your wakeboard to determine the minimum size bag you’ll need – you’ll want a bag that’s at least as long as your board, and preferably a bit wider to accommodate your bindings and other gear. You should also consider the thickness of your wakeboard and whether you’ll need a bag with extra padding to protect it.

Once you have an idea of the size bag you need, you can start looking at different options and comparing their dimensions to your gear. Don’t be afraid to read reviews and ask for recommendations from other wakeboarders to get a sense of which bags are the most popular and well-regarded. And remember, it’s always better to err on the side of caution and choose a bag that’s a bit larger than you think you’ll need – you can always use the extra space to carry other gear or accessories, and you’ll be glad you have the room if you need it.

How do I clean and maintain my wakeboarding equipment bag to extend its lifespan?

Cleaning and maintaining your wakeboarding equipment bag is easy – just follow a few simple steps to keep it in good condition. First, start by wiping down the exterior of the bag with a damp cloth to remove any dirt or debris. You can also use a mild soap and water to clean any stubborn stains or spots. Be sure to avoid using har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ners, as these can damage the fabric or harm the environment. If you need to clean the interior of the bag, you can use a soft-bristled brush or a lint roller to remove any dirt or debris that may have accumulated.

In addition to regular cleaning, there are a few other things you can do to extend the lifespan of your wakeboarding equipment bag. First, be sure to dry the bag thoroughly after each use – this will help prevent moisture buildup and keep your gear dry. You should also store the bag in a cool, dry place when not in use, away from direct sunlight or extreme temperatures. Finally, consider applying a waterproofing treatment to the bag to help protect it from the elements – this can be especially useful if you plan to use the bag in wet or humid conditions. By following these simple steps, you can help extend the lifespan of your wakeboarding equipment bag and keep it in good condition for years to come.
